More still went to RCA records, sole owner of all of Elvis' music before 1973, thanks to a $5.4-million deal Parker arranged in that year. RCA agreed to pay the estate $1 million to settle the suit and 10 future installments of $110,000 each. In 1982, Presley's former wife, Priscilla, and the other trustees of the estate won permission to open the mansion to tourists. Today, the mansion draws more than 500,000 visitors a year and generates between $8 million to $9 million in souvenir and ticket sales.
